Transaction 5b3858a6399d31a94eedae8adf70a5af2ac34a929496b8207a371d9aabccf32b
1 Input
1 Output
-
5b3858a6399d31a94eedae8adf70a5af2ac34a929496b8207a371d9aabccf32b:0
- value
- 153758
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ba577b0f9a6fc2148cacd924ceab7b7a5ba368db
- address
- bc1qhfthkru6dlppfr9vmyjva2mm0fd6x6xm6qdu59